Ordinals
beta
Address 1JhGXNaKtRWutWVyNQvqmfB3QKoyvqf3bK
sat balance
133524
outputs
0063f266564b470aa689d15451f38ce0c5a2850ea6ae2b0074959f2c070b5c3a:0
e03ab9d838da42c11f70ff787027d687ac967cc371d88085a98b51d194943f4d:1
af34b043032f1040336d28d711c4ff91b06789bb8b7e5040d088ee0205531b67:1